Mike Conley will miss Thursday’s game against the Thunder due to back spasms. Over the past two weeks, Conley has averaged just under 20 minutes per game for the Wolves, contributing minimally to their offense. Davion Mitchell will miss his fifth consecutive game due to a shoulder injury, sidelining him for Thursday’s matchup against the Bulls. With both Mitchell and Tyler Herro unavailable, Kasparas Jakučionis will continue to fill the role of starting point guard. However, Jakučionis has yet to establish himself as a viable option in fantasy basketball leagues.

Grant Williams will miss Thursday’s game against the Mavericks as part of right knee injury management. The Hornets have been careful with Williams following his offseason knee surgery, limiting him to under 19 minutes per game in recent weeks. Expect Charlotte to allocate additional playing time to Tidjane Salaun to cover Williams’ absence.

Portland Trail Blazers’ Duop Reath will miss the remainder of the season after undergoing surgery for a right foot stress fracture. Reath, who had been averaging 8.2 minutes over 32 games, has been sidelined since January 18.
